2009 Jeep Liberty

The Jeep Liberty is quite capable off road, one of the best in its class. Compared to the Jeep Patriot and Compass, the Liberty is more of a true Jeep, with off-road prowess and bold, upright styling.

The Jeep Liberty was all-new for 2008, and is further improved for 2009, with refinements to its suspension, steering, and brakes.

Retail Price

$23,015 - $27,730 MSRP / Window Sticker Price
Engine 3.7L V-6
MPG Up to 16 city / 22 highway
Seating 5 Passengers
Transmission 4-spd auto w/OD
Power 210 @ 5200 rpm
Drivetrain four-wheel, rear-wheel
Curb Weight 3,985 - 4,278 lbs
